Jazz Masters 2012 - The 30th and Final Class (Updated)
Source:
Ken Franckling's Jazz Notes
Call it overdue honors for Vonski and more The National Endowment for the Arts has announced the recipients of the 2012 NEA Jazz Masters Awardthe nation's highest honor in jazz. The five recipients are drummer-keyboardist Jack DeJohnette, saxophonist Von Freeman, bassist and composer Charlie Haden, singer Sheila Jordan and trumpeter Jimmy Owens (pictured). Jazzed Media's Stan Kenton Documentary Honored with Videographer Award
Source:
Michael Bloom Media Relations
The Videographer Awards has honored Jazzed Media with a 2011 Videographer Award of Excellence for the documentary film Stan Kenton: Artistry in Rhythm- Portrait of a Jazz Legend. The documentary film was produced and directed by multi-Grammy nominated producer and award winning filmmaker Graham Carter, founder of Jazzed Media. Riverfront Times Announces 2011 Music Awards Winners
Source:
St. Louis Jazz Notes by Dean Minderman
The Riverfront Times announced the winners of the paper's 2011 Music Awards at a ceremony held Tuesday night at the downtown rock club, the Firebird. Guitarist Dave Black (pictured) was named Best Jazz Artist" in the RFT's online reader poll, while the combo platter of singer Roland Johnson and the Voodoo Blues Band snagged this year's Best Blues Artist" award. Music for Lifelong Achievement and Horns to Havana Instrument Drive Garners Seventeen Instruments for Schools in Havana, Cuba
Source:
Jennifer Kramer
ST. LOUIS, MOMusic for Lifelong Achievement (MFLA) has wrapped up a successful instrument drive for Horns to Havana, a non-profit organization based out of The Center For Cuban Studies in New York City. The drive, which took place from February through May, garnered seventeen instruments including a trumpet, saxophone, keyboard, three guitars, three trombones, four flutes and four clarinets. Stanley Clarke Set To Be Honored At Montreal Jazz Festival With Esteemed Miles Davis Award June 26
Source:
Diane Hadley
Stanley Clarke will be the 18th recipient of the Miles Davis Award at the Montreal Jazz Festival June 26, 8:00 p.m., Salle Wilfrid-Peiletier venue. The award will be presented before his festival performance with Return To Forever. The Miles Davis Award was created in 1994 to honor a great international jazz musician for the entire body of his or her work and for that musician's influence in regenerating the jazz idiom. JazzBoston Organizes Local Awards Party for Wally's Cafe on Saturday June 11
Source:
Chris Rich
Elynor Walcott and sons Paul, Frank, and Lloyd Poindexter, who own and run the storied Wally's Café, in Boston, have been named 2011 Jazz Heroes" by the Jazz Journalists Association. Established in 1947 by Elynor Walcott's father, Joseph L.
